The vertices of the triangle are A(5, 4, 6), B(1, –1, 3) and C(4, 3, 2). The internal bisector of angle A meets BC at D. Find the coordinates of D and the length AD.

Open in App
Solution



AB = 42+52+32=16+25+9=50=52
AC = 12+12+42=18=32
AD is the internal bisector of BAC.
BDDC=ABAC=53
Thus, D divides BC internally in the ratio 5:3.
